The Awa Maru (阿波丸) was a Japanese ocean liner owned by Nippon Yusen Kaisha. The ship was built in 1899 by Mitsubishi Shipbuilding & Engineering Co. at Nagasaki, Japan. The ship's name comes in part from the ancient province of Awa. This turn-of-the-20th-century Awa Maru was the first NYK vessel to bear this name. A second mid-century, 11,249 ton Awa Maru was completed in 1943.
